   3. TEST METHODOLOGY
   The measurement procedure described in the American National Standard for Testing Unlicensed
   Wireless Devices(ANSI C63.10-2009).



   3.1 EUT CONFIGURATION
   The EUT configuration for testing is installed on RF field strength measurement to meet the
   Commissions requirement and operating in a manner that intends to maximize its emission
   characteristics in a continuous normal application.


   3.2 EUT EXERCISE
   The EUT was operated in the engineering mode to fix the Tx frequency that was for the purpose of
   the measurements. According to its specifications, the EUT must comply with the requirements of
   the Section 15.207, 15.209 and 15.225 under the FCC Rules Part 15 Subpart C.


   3.3 GENERAL TEST PROCEDURES

   Conducted Emissions
   The EUT is placed on the turntable, which is 0.8 m above ground plane. According to the
   requirements in Section 6.2 of ANSI C63.10. (Version :2009) Conducted emissions from the EUT
   measured in the frequency range between 0.15 MHz and 30MHz using CISPR Quasi-peak and
   average detector modes.
   Radiated Emissions
   The EUT is placed on a turn table, which is 0.8 m above ground plane. The turntable shall rotate
   360 degrees to determine the position of maximum emission level. EUT is set 3 m away from the
   receiving antenna, which varied from 1 m to 4 m to find out the highest emission. And also, each
   emission was to be maximized by changing the polarization of receiving antenna both horizontal
   and vertical. In order to find out the max. emission, the relative positions of this hand-held
   transmitter (EUT) was rotated through three orthogonal axes according to the requirements in
   Section 6.3 of ANSI C63.10. (Version: 2009).

   Radiated emissions are measured with one or more of the following types of Linearly polarized
   antennas: tuned loop, dipole, bi-conical, log periodic, bi-log, and/or ridged waveguide, horn.
   Spectrum analyzers with pre-selectors and quasi-peak detectors are used to perform radiated
   measurements.
   Conducted emissions are measured with Line Impedance Stabilization Networks and EMI Test
   Receivers. Calibrated wideband preamplifiers, coaxial cables, and coaxial attenuators are also
   used for making measurements.
   All receiving equipment conforms to CISPR Publication 16-1, “Radio Interference Measuring
   Apparatus and Measurement Methods.”


   6. ANTENNA REQUIREMENTS

   According to FCC 47 CFR §15.203:
    “An intentional radiator antenna shall be designed to ensure that no antenna other than that
   furnished by the responsible party can be used with the device. The use of a permanently attached
   antenna or of an antenna that uses a unique coupling to the intentional radiator shall be
   considered sufficient to comply with the provisions of this section.”


   * The antennas of this E.U.T are permanently attached.


   *The E.U.T Complies with the requirement of §15.203

   8. RADIATED EMISSION MEASUREMENT

   Requirement(s): 15.209, 15.225

   Except as provided elsewhere in this paragraph the emissions from an intentional radiator shall not exceed
   the field strength levels specified in the following table:

      Minimum Standard: FCC Part 15.225 / 15.209
             Rule Part              Frequency (MHz)                                         Limit

                                       0.009 ~ 0.490                                2400/F(kHz) uV/m@300 m

                                       0.490 ~1.705                               24000/F(kHz) uV/m@30 m

                                           1.705 ~ 30                                 30 uV/m@30 m

          Part 15.209                       30 ~ 88                                  100 ** uV/m@3 m

                                           88 ~ 216                                   150 ** uV/m@3 m

                                           216 ~ 960                                  200 ** uV/m@3 m

                                           Above 960                                   500 uV/m@3 m

    ** Except as provided in 15.209(g), fundamental emissions from intentional radiators operating under this Section shall

    not be located in the frequency bands 54-72 MHz, 76-88 MHz, 174-216 MHz or 470-806 MHz. However, operation

    within these frequency bands is permitted under other sections of this Part, e.g. 15.231 and 15.241.

   15.225 Operation within the band 13.110 – 14.010 MHz.
   (a) The field strength of any emissions within the band 13.553-13.567 MHz shall not exceed 15,848 microvolts/meter (=

   84 dBuV/m) at 30 meters.

   (b) Within the bands 13.410-13.553 MHz and 13.567-13.710 MHz, the field strength of any emissions shall not exceed

   334 microvolts/meter (=50.5dBuV/m) at 30 meters.

   (c) Within the bands 13.110-13.410 MHz and 13.710-14.010 MHz the field strength of any emissions shall not exceed

   106 microvolts/meter (=40.5 dBuV/m) at 30 meters.

   (d) The field strength of any emissions appearing outside of the 13.110-14.010 MHz band shall not exceed the general

   radiated emission limits in § 15.209.

   (e) The frequency tolerance of the carrier signal shall be maintained within +/- 0.01% of the operating frequency over a

   temperature variation of –20 degrees to +50 degrees C at normal supply voltage, and for a variation in the primary

   supply voltage from 85% to 115% of the rated supply voltage at a temperature of 20 degrees C. For battery operated

   equipment, the equipment tests shall be performed using a new battery.

   (f) In the case of radio frequency powered tags designed to operate with a device authorized under this section, the tag

   may be approved with the device or be considered as a separate device subject to its own authorization. Powered tags

   approved with a device under a single application shall be labeled with the same identification number as the device.

   8.1. RADIATED EMISSION 9 kHz – 30 MHz

   Test Set-up


                                              3 meters


                                                                         EUT




                                                                                   AC-DC           AC mains

          Spectrum
          analyzer



   Test Procedure
   The EUT was placed on a non-conductive table located on a large open test site.
   The loop antenna was placed at a location 3m from the EUT. Radiated emissions were measured with the
   loop antenna both parallel and perpendicular to the plane of the EUT loop antenna and with x, y, z planes in
   EUT.

   The limit is converted from microvolts/meter to decibel microvolts/meter. Sample Calculation:


   Corrected Amplitude = Raw Amplitude(dBµV/m) + ACF(dB) + Cable Loss(dB) – Distance Correction Factor



   The spectrum analyzer is set to:
   Frequency Range = 9 kHz ~ 1 GHz
   RBW      = 9 kHz (9 kHz ~ 30 MHz)
         = 120 kHz (30 MHz ~ 1 GHz)

   Trace Mode = max hold
   Detector Mode = peak / Quasi-peak
   Sweep time = auto

    Note :

         1. Distance Correction Below 30MHz = 40log(3m/30m) = - 40 dB
              Measurement Distance : 3 m (Below 30 MHz)
         2. Factor = Antenna Factor + Cable Loss
         3. Result Level = Read Level + Factor + Distance Correction
         4. Margin = Limit – Result Level
         5. We have done x, y, z planes in EUT
         6.   Antenna rotated about its vertical/horizontal axis for maximum response at each
              azimuth position around the EUT.
         7. Worst case of operating mode is type A, analog mode and 106 kbps.
         8. ‘*’ is the result for restricted band.

   10. FREQUENCY TOLERANCE

   Procedure: Part 15.225, ANSI 63.10


   If required, the operating or transmitting frequency of an intentional radiator should be measured in
   accordance with the following procedure to ensure that the device operates outside certain precluded
   frequency bands and within the frequency range. No modulation needs to be supplied to the intentional
   radiator during these tests, unless modulation is required to produce an output, e.g., single-sideband
   suppressed carrier transmitters.


   The frequency stability of the transmitter is measured by:


   a) Temperature: The temperature is varied from -20°C to + 50°C using an environmental chamber.


   b) For battery operated equipment, the equipment tests shall be performed using a new battery.


   The frequency tolerance of the carrier signal shall be maintained within +/- 0.01% of the operating frequency.

   11. POWERLINE CONDUCTE EMISSIONS
   LIMIT
   For an intentional radiator which is designed to be connected to the public utility (AC) power line,
   the radio frequency voltage that is conducted back onto the AC power line on any frequency or
   frequencies within the band 150 kHz to 30 MHz shall not exceed 250 microvolt (The limit
   decreases linearly with the logarithm of the frequency in the range 0.15 MHz to 0.50 MHz). The
   limits at specific frequency range is listed as follows:


                                                                 Limits (dBμV)
        Frequency Range (MHz)
                                                   Quasi-peak                        Average

                0.15 to 0.50                         66 to 56                         56 to 46

                  0.50 to 5                             56                               46

                   5 to 30                              60                               50


   Compliance with this provision shall be based on the measurement of the radio frequency
   voltage between each power line (LINE and NEUTRAL) and ground at the power terminals.


   Test Configuration
   See test photographs attached in Appendix 1 for the actual connections between EUT and support
   equipment.


   TEST PROCEDURE
   1. The EUT is placed on a wooden table 80 cm above the reference ground plane.
   2. The EUT is connected via LISN to a test power supply.
   3. The measurement results are obtained as described below:
   4. Detectors – Quasi Peak and Average Detector.
   5. The EUT is the device with a detachable antenna operating below 30 MHz.
     - For unterminated the Antenna, the AC line conducted tests are performed with the antenna
     connected
     - For terminated the Antenna, the AC line conducted tests are performed with a dummy load
     connected to the EUT antenna output terminal.
